What Does a Mortgage Refinance Company in Grand Forks Cost?

Typical costs for refinancing a mortgage in North Dakota include an appraisal fee of 400 to 700 dollars, loan origination fees of 0.5 to 1 percent of the loan amount, and title insurance costs of 500 to 1,000 dollars. Closing costs often total 2 to 5 percent of the loan principal. These amounts vary by lender and property value. This is general information and not mortgage or financial advice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What documents do I need to refinance a mortgage in Grand Forks?
You typically need pay stubs, tax returns, bank statements, and proof of homeowners insurance. North Dakota lenders also require a property appraisal. Check with your chosen company for their specific list.
How long does a mortgage refinance take in North Dakota?
A standard refinance in North Dakota usually takes 30 to 45 days from application to closing. Delays can occur if the appraisal or title search takes longer. Your lender will provide a timeline estimate.
